Systems and methods for audio scene generation by effecting control of the vibrations of a panel
A loudspeaker system composed of a flexible panel with an affixed array of force actuators, a signal processing system, and interface electronic circuits is described. The system described is capable of creating a pattern of standing bending waves at any location on the panel and the instantaneous amplitude, velocity, or acceleration of the standing waves can be controlled by an audio signal to create localized acoustic sources at the selected locations in the plane of the panel.
MICROMECHANICAL SOUND TRANSDUCER
A micromechanical sound transducer according to a first aspect includes a first bending transducer with a free end and a second bending transducer with a free end, the two bending transducers being arranged in a mutual plane, wherein the free end of the first bending transducer is separated from the free end of the second bending transducer via a slit. The second bending transducer is excited in-phase with the vertical vibration of the first bending transducer. A micromechanical sound transducer according to a second aspect includes a first bending transducer that is excited to vibrate vertically and a diaphragm element extending vertically to the first bending transducer, the diaphragm element being separated from a free end of the first bending transducer via a slit.
REFRIGERATOR WITH SOUND REPRODUCING CAPABILITY
A refrigerator with a sound reproducing capability is provided. The refrigerator may include a cabinet forming an exterior of the refrigerator and having an upper surface portion, a lower surface portion, a side surface portion, and a rear surface portion, a door coupled to the cabinet, a vibration module attached to an inner surface of at least one among the door, the upper surface portion, the side surface portion, the rear surface portion, and the lower surface portion, and a controller configured to control vibration of the vibration module. The vibration strength of the vibration module and power supplied to the vibration module may be determined by a trained model trained through machine learning, an area of artificial intelligence (AI). In addition, the refrigerator may include a communicator, and may operate in conjunction with an external device via 5G communication.

Electromagnetic actuator for a display with improved spring arrangement and output device with said actuator
The invention relates to an electromagnetic actuator, which is designed to be connected to a backside of a plate like structure and which comprises an annular coil arrangement and a magnet system being designed to generate a magnetic field transverse to the annular coil arrangement. The annular coil arrangement and the magnet system are connected to each other by a plurality of springs, which are arranged inside of the annular coil arrangement. Furthermore, the invention relates to an output device, comprising a plate like structure and an electromagnetic actuator of the above kind connected to a backside of the plate like structure.

SPEAKER DEVICE AND SOUND OUTPUT METHOD
A speaker device according to an embodiment includes a vibration element, a driving unit, and a panel. The driving unit applies, to the vibration element, a driving signal where a carrier wave in an ultrasonic wave band is modulated by a sound signal in an audible wave band. The panel is provided with the vibration element and arranged in such a manner that a driving signal is applied to such a vibration element by the driving unit to form a vibration region and first and second ultrasonic waves that are generated from such a vibration region and travel in mutually different directions travel toward respectively different users.
FLAT PANEL LOUDSPEAKER WITH OVERHANGING PANEL AND METHOD OF INSTALLATION THEREOF
A flat panel loudspeaker configured for mounting in an opening in a mounting surface includes a planar resonant panel configured to be inserted into an opening in the mounting surface and having a front surface and a rear surface. The flat panel loudspeaker also includes an exciter coupled to the rear surface and configured to cause an active portion of the planar resonant panel to vibrate and generate sound. An outer boundary of the active portion of the planar resonant panel is fixed relative to the mounting surface, the outer boundary defining the active portion as an area of the planar resonant panel. The planar resonant panel comprises an edge portion extending beyond the outer boundary of the active portion in at least one direction. The edge portion is configured to overlap the mounting surface.
